What to Expect During Installation
When you hire a professional pet door installer, you can expect the following actions in the installation process:
- Consultation: The installer will evaluate your home and discuss your choices to figure out the very best type and size of the pet door.
- Choosing the Location: The location for the pet door is crucial. Installers will help choose the most suitable spot thinking about both your pet's requirements and your home layout.
- Preparation: The installers will gather the needed tools and products and prepare the location.
- Installation: This includes cutting the door, fitting the pet door, and sealing it to avoid drafts and leaks. Specialists typically have specialized tools to ensure the job is done properly.
- Final Adjustments: The installer will make any modifications needed and make sure the pet door opens and closes smoothly.
- Testing: After installation, they will check the pet door to ensure it works effortlessly for your pet.
Various Types of Pet Doors
Not all pet doors are produced equal. They are available in various styles and modifications to cater to different home environments and pet requirements. Here's a list of popular types of pet doors:
| Type of Pet Door | Description |
|---|---|
| Flap Doors | Easy and economical, these timeless doors have a versatile flap that pets can push through. |
| Electronic/Smart Doors | These doors include automated opening systems activated by a sensing unit probably connected to your pet's collar. |
| Wall-Mounted Doors | Installed into a wall instead of a door, best for particular architectural designs. |
| Moving Glass Pet Doors | Created for moving glass doors, these doors use security and convenience by permitting easy access. |
| Screened Pet Doors | Developed for ventilation, these doors also enable family pets to let themselves out while keeping insects and debris out. |
Elements to Consider When Choosing a Pet Door
Picking the very best pet door for your home and pet needs cautious factor to consider. Pet owners should take note of numerous aspects:
- Size: The size of the pet door should conveniently accommodate your pet.
- Product: Look for durable materials that endure wear and tear, and suitable for your environment.
- Energy Efficiency: A well-sealed door can help preserve your home's temperature level, minimizing energy bills.
- Security Features: Opt for doors that provide locking systems or other security measures, specifically for bigger family pets.
Cost of Professional Pet Door Installation
The cost of installing a pet door can differ widely based on a number of aspects:
| Cost Factors | Estimated Price Range |
|---|---|
| Type of Pet Door | ₤ 150 - ₤ 600 |
| Installation Complexity | ₤ 100 - ₤ 300 |
| Area of Installation | ₤ 100 - ₤ 200 (wall vs. door) |
| Additional Features | ₤ 50 - ₤ 100 (security, electronic, and so on) |
| Labor | ₤ 50 - ₤ 150/hour |
In general, pet owners can expect to invest anywhere from ₤ 250 to over ₤ 1,500 for the purchase and installation of a quality pet door, depending on their special requirements.
